The aggressive pricing strategy adopted by Apple for its 3G iPhone will have limited impact on High Tech Computer’s (HTC’s) handset sales, according to Peter Chou, CEO of HTC. Apple unveiled its 3G iPhone on June 10, with the devices to be more "more affordable" for consumers, starting at $199.
